When My Mother Asked to Move Back In, I Said No The Heartbreaking Family Dilemma That Followed

Family relationships can be complicated, especially when abandonment leaves lasting scars.

A young woman shares her struggle when her estranged mother reappears decades later, gravely ill and asking for help.

At 11, her mother left for another relationship, and her father raised her alone with quiet devotion. Growing up without a mother left deep wounds,

but she built a stable life on her own. At 29, after her father’s death, she believed her mother was gone from her story.

Then came a call: her mother, sick and lonely, wanted to reconnect and move back into the family home. The daughter refused, telling her,

“You didn’t raise me. You left.” But the next day, police found her mother collapsed outside her door with suitcases, waiting for acceptance that never came.

Guilt set in, yet she held her boundary. She had mourned her mother long ago and could not reopen those wounds. The story asks

a hard question: are children obligated to care for parents who abandoned them? For many, compassion conflicts with self-preservation.

Her decision wasn’t heartless but courageous—choosing survival over reopening pain. Love and forgiveness are never simple, and sometimes peace means saying no.
